Core i3-1215U vs Ryzen 5 7520U comparison

Our benchmark analysis concludes that the Core i3-1215U performs better than the Ryzen 5 7520U. Furthermore, our gaming benchmark shows that it also outperforms the Ryzen 5 7520U in all gaming tests too.

With info from our database, we find that the Core i3-1215U has significantly more cores with 6 cores whereas the Ryzen 5 7520U has 4 cores. But they both have the same number of threads. Our comparison shows that the Ryzen 5 7520U has a significantly higher clock speed compared to the Core i3-1215U. Despite this, the Core i3-1215U has a slightly higher turbo speed. Both these chips have an identical TDP (Thermal Design Power). This measures the amount of heat they output and can be used to estimate power consumption. In terms of cache, the Core i3-1215U has significantly more L2 cache when compared to the Ryzen 5 7520U. The Core i3-1215U also has significantly more L3 cache.

The more cores a CPU has, the better the overall performance will be in parallel workloads such as multitasking. Many CPUs have more threads than cores, this means that each physical core is split into multiple logical cores, making them more efficient. Indeed, the Core i3-1215U has more threads than cores.
